Jay Pateakos Jay Pateakos, a former full-time newspaper journalist, started his theatre review journey more than 10 years ago and has reviewed more than a hundred plays for the Herald News of Fall River and Cape Cod Times for performances at Providence Performing Arts Center, Trinity Repertory, Zeiterion Theatre and more than a dozen theaters across Cape Cod. He has been reviewing for Broadway World Rhode Island since the fall of 2021. | |

John McDaid John G. McDaid is an award-winning science fiction writer and freelance journalist from Portsmouth, RI. He grew up in NYC, where visits to Broadway sparked a life-long love of theater. He worked both on-stage and off during college — including as tech director on a national tour — before moving into a career in corporate communications. A graduate of New School University with an MFA in fiction from Salve Regina Univeristy, he did doctoral work in media ecology at NYU and is an adjunct professor of communications at Roger Williams University. He is a member of the American Theatre Critics Association, and sees as many shows as he can in Rhode Island -- and beyond. |
